三大范式通俗解释
1、简单归纳:第一范式(1NF):字段不可分;第二范式(2NF):有主键,非主键字段依赖主键;第三范式(3NF):非主键字段不能相互依赖。
2、解释:1NF:原子性。字段不可再分,否则就不是关系数据库;2NF:唯一性,一个表只说明一个事物;3NF:每列都与主键有直接关系,不存在传递依赖。
数据库的三大范式是什么
数据库中三大范式的定义如下:
1、第一范式:
当关系模式R的所有属性都不能在分解为更基本的数据单位时,称R是满足第一范式的,简记为1NF。满足第一范式是关系模式规范化的最低要求,否则,将有很多基本操作在这样的关系模式中实现不了。
2、第二范式:
如果关系模式R满足第一范式,并且R得所有非主属性都完全依赖于R的每一个候选关键属性,称R满足第二范式,简记为2NF。
3、第三范式:
设R是一个满足第一范式条件的关系模式,X是R的任意属性集,如果X非传递依赖于R的任意一个候选关键字,称R满足第三范式,简记为3NF。
范式简介:
范式来自英文Normal form,简称NF。要想设计—个好的关系,必须使关系满足一定的约束条件,此约束已经形成了规范,分成几个等级,一级比一级要求得严格。
满足这些规范的数据库是简洁的、结构明晰的,同时,不会发生插入(insert)、删除(delete)和更新(update)操作异常。反之则是乱七八糟,不仅给数据库的编程人员制造麻烦,而且面目可憎,可能存储了大量不需要的冗余信息。
关系数据库有六种范式:第一范式(1NF)、第二范式(2NF)、第三范式(3NF)、巴斯-科德范式(BCNF)、第四范式(4NF)和第五范式(5NF,又称完美范式)。满足最低要求的范式是第一范式(1NF)。在第一范式的基础上进一步满足更多规范要求的称为第二范式(2NF),其余范式以次类推。一般来说,数据库只需满足第三范式(3NF)就行了。
社会学三大范式是什么
社会学三大范式是指以涂尔干为代表的实证主义,以韦伯为代表的解释主义,以马克思为代表的批判主义。
1、以孔德(A.Comte)、斯宾塞(H.Spencer)等社会学创始者为代表,并经古典社会学的代表人物涂尔干(E.Durkheim)发展后日趋成熟,他们认为社会现象和自然现象之间并无本质的区别,它们遵循着同样的方法论准则,都可以用普遍的因果律加以说明。
2、以韦伯(M.Weber)等古典社会学家为代表,认为社会现象有其独特的性质和规律,绝不能盲目效仿自然科学方法来研究社会科学,而应确立自己独特的研究方法。
3、马克思(K.Marx)开创的批判主义社会学研究传统_认为社会学理论知识的主要任务和作用就在于对现实社会的批判性检视,其基本特征就是不断强调社会学理论批判的、革命的性质,强调理论和理论家在改造、变革现实社会中的重要作用,反对那种旨在维护、修补现存社会结构的单纯解释性的“科学”研究和把现代工业社会的既定现实当作合法的做法。
社会学简介
社会学是系统地研究社会行为与人类群体的社会科学,起源于19世纪三四十年代,是从社会哲学演化出来的一门现代学科,社会学是一门具有多重研究方式的学科,主要涉及科学主义实证论的定量方法和人文主义的理解方法,它们相互对立、相互联系,共同发展及完善一套有关人类社会结构及活动的知识体系,并以运用这些知识去寻求或改善社会福利为主要目标。
三大范式
第一范式(1NF)、第二范式(2NF)、第三范式(3NF)、巴斯-科德范式(BCNF)。满足最低要求的范式是第一范式(1NF)。在第一范式的基础上进一步满足更多规范要求的称为第二范式(2NF),其余范式以此类推。一般说来,数据库只需满足第三范式(3NF)就行了。 扩展资料 1、1NF:字段不可分,每个字段是原子级别的,上节中看到第一个字段为ID,它就是ID不能在分成两个字段了,不能说我要把这个人的ID、名称、班级号都塞在一个字段里面,这个是不合适的,对以后的应用造成很大影响;
2、2NF:有主键,非主键字段依赖主键,ID字段就是主键,它能表示这一条数据是唯一的,有的读者朋友记性很好,“unique”表示唯一的、不允许重复的,确实它经常会修饰某个字段,保证该字段唯一性,然后再设置该字段为主键;
3、3NF:非主键字段不能相互依赖,这个怎么理解呢,比如student表,班级编号受人员编号的影响,如果在这个表中再插入班级的.班主任、数学老师等信息,你们觉得这样合适吗?肯定不合适,因为学生有多个,这样就会造成班级有多个,那么每个班级的班主任、数学老师都会出现多条数据,而我们理想中的效果应该是一条班级信息对应一个班主任和数学老师,这样更易于我们理解,这样就形成class表,那么student表和class表中间靠哪个字段来关联呢,肯定是通过“classNo”,这个字段也叫做两个表的外键,后面讲约束的时候老韩会重点讲这个,读者朋友先有个大致了解。
以上就是关于三大范式通俗解释,数据库的三大范式是什么的全部内容,以及三大范式通俗解释的相关内容,希望能够帮到您。
版权声明:本文来自用户投稿,不代表【易百科】立场,本平台所发表的文章、图片属于原权利人所有,因客观原因,或会存在不当使用的情况,非恶意侵犯原权利人相关权益,敬请相关权利人谅解并与我们联系(邮箱:350149276@qq.com)我们将及时处理,共同维护良好的网络创作环境。